diff options
author | AUTOMATIC1111 <16777216c@gmail.com> | 2023-05-20 19:24:15 +0000 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-05-20 19:24:15 +0000 |
commit | cc6c0fc70a8fee1ea01a5e1a63d4edd645b26687 (patch) | |
tree | 04ec2afdaa48c04a0bf69fcf0b5ad7dcc999498f /modules/ui_extra_networks.py | |
parent | db1ce5aa2654df2f6a2112b4e6cc6f88f9c519df (diff) | |
parent | 71f4a4afdfe2da8cbf23a74b82c32b4d113d996e (diff) | |
download | stable-diffusion-webui-gfx803-cc6c0fc70a8fee1ea01a5e1a63d4edd645b26687.tar.gz stable-diffusion-webui-gfx803-cc6c0fc70a8fee1ea01a5e1a63d4edd645b26687.tar.bz2 stable-diffusion-webui-gfx803-cc6c0fc70a8fee1ea01a5e1a63d4edd645b26687.zip |
Merge pull request #10557 from akx/dedupe-webui-boot
Refactor & deduplicate web UI boot code
Diffstat (limited to 'modules/ui_extra_networks.py')
-rw-r--r-- | modules/ui_extra_networks.py |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/modules/ui_extra_networks.py b/modules/ui_extra_networks.py index 80cfa841..19fbaae5 100644 --- a/modules/ui_extra_networks.py +++ b/modules/ui_extra_networks.py @@ -232,10 +232,19 @@ class ExtraNetworksPage: return None
-def intialize():
+def initialize():
extra_pages.clear()
+def register_default_pages():
+ from modules.ui_extra_networks_textual_inversion import ExtraNetworksPageTextualInversion
+ from modules.ui_extra_networks_hypernets import ExtraNetworksPageHypernetworks
+ from modules.ui_extra_networks_checkpoints import ExtraNetworksPageCheckpoints
+ register_page(ExtraNetworksPageTextualInversion())
+ register_page(ExtraNetworksPageHypernetworks())
+ register_page(ExtraNetworksPageCheckpoints())
+
+
class ExtraNetworksUi:
def __init__(self):
self.pages = None
|